My concern is not to persuade, but rather to discuss with you some of the ways that, what I term “The Buddy System in Mathematics Learning” may improve the mathematics curriculum. How can we make the learning of mathematics more stimulating, more realistic, and, above all, more enjoyable for the children in our classrooms? It is my feeling that one way is by cooperative efforts of small groups of people, at all levels of the elementary school strata. To have cooperative efforts, or a “Buddy System” there must be a play of minds. Two heads are better than one, but it often takes three or more to make a decision.
